WebWhen you sell or transfer your vehicle you must notify the DVLA straight away using the V5C part of your registration document. Remember by law, it is the seller's responsibility to tell the DVLA about the change of keeper. If you don't do this you commit an offence and you will still be liable for the vehicle. WebApr 17, 2024 · It is not the case if the car is sold to a motor trader or dealer as they are not officially classed as a registered keeper. If you sell or part exchange the car to a dealer the yellow Section 4 slip is filled out with their business name, business address, VAT number and date of transfer. You must send Section 4 to DVLA, Swansea, SA99 1BA. citizens advice southend housing supportWebNotify DVLA. Complete Section 10 – transferring or selling a car to the motor trade. Include the dealer’s business name, address, VAT number and date of sale. Send the slip to DVLA Swansea SA99 1BA.
